Miryung Kim is a scholar working on Information Systems, Software and Computer Networks and Communications. According to data from OpenAlex, Miryung Kim has authored 114 papers receiving a total of 4.8k indexed citations (citations by other indexed papers that have themselves been cited), including 88 papers in Information Systems, 64 papers in Software and 47 papers in Computer Networks and Communications. Recurrent topics in Miryung Kim's work include Software Engineering Research (69 papers), Software Testing and Debugging Techniques (48 papers) and Software System Performance and Reliability (41 papers). Miryung Kim is often cited by papers focused on Software Engineering Research (69 papers), Software Testing and Debugging Techniques (48 papers) and Software System Performance and Reliability (41 papers). Miryung Kim collaborates with scholars based in United States, Canada and United Kingdom. Miryung Kim's co-authors include David Notkin, Thomas Zimmermann, Gail C. Murphy, Vibha Sazawal, Baishakhi Ray, Nachiappan Nagappan, Kathryn S. McKinley, Napol Rachatasumrit, Na Meng and Muhammad Ali Gulzar and has published in prestigious journals such as IEEE Transactions on Software Engineering, Proceedings of the VLDB Endowment and IEEE Software.
